Ingredients
- Waffle Batter: 2 cups all-purpose flour 2 tbsp brown sugar 1 tbsp baking powder 1/2 tsp baking soda 1/2 tsp salt 2 tsp ground ginger 1 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on 1/4 tsp ground cloves 1/4 tsp ground nutmeg 3 large eggs 1 3/4 cups milk 1/4 cup unsalted butter melted 1/4 cup unsulphured molasses 1 tsp vanilla extract
- Toppings & Decorations: 1 cup whipped cream 1 cup mini marshmallows 1 cup assorted holiday candies (gumdrops, chocolate buttons, etc.) 1/2 cup crushed peppermint candies 1/2 cup chocolate chips 1/2 cup small pretzel sticks 1/2 cup sliced strawberries 1/2 cup banana slices 1/4 cup maple syrup 1/4 cup powdered sugar
Instructions
- Step 1:
- Preheat your waffle iron according to manufacturer instructions.
- Step 2:
- In a large bowl, whisk together flour, brown sugar, baking powder, baking soda, salt, ginger, cinnamon, cloves, and nutmeg.
- Step 3:
- In a separate bowl, whisk eggs, milk, melted butter, molasses, and vanilla extract until well combined.
- Step 4:
-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and mix until just combined (do not overmix).
- Step 5:
- Lightly grease the waffle iron. Pour batter onto the hot iron, using about 1/2 cup per waffle (adjust for size), and cook until golden and crisp. Repeat with remaining batter.
- Step 6:
- Arrange waffles on a platter. Set out toppings and decorations buffet-style so everyone can build and decorate their own gingerbread waffle house.
- Step 7:
- Serve immediately, dusted with powdered sugar and drizzled with maple syrup if desired.

Required Tools
Waffle iron Mixing bowls Whisk Measuring cups and spoons Serving platters and bowls
Allergen Information
Contains Wheat (gluten) eggs milk and possibly nuts/soy (from candies and chocolate) Double-check candy and chocolate ingredients for allergens
Nutritional Information
Calories 420 Total Fat 13 g Carbohydrates 68 g Protein 8 g per serving

Recipe FAQ
- → What spices are used in the waffle batter?
The batter includes ginger, cinnamon, cloves, nutmeg, and a hint of vanilla for warm, festive flavor.
- → How should the waffles be cooked?
Preheat the waffle iron, lightly grease it, and cook batter until waffles are golden and crisp, about 3-5 minutes each.
- → Can this be adapted for gluten-free diets?
Yes. Subst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end without altering other ingredients.
